> Re: your second question on the progress bar
>
> I think this refers back to recent discussions on auto-completion of a
> parent task when all sub tasks have been completed. Some of it may
> come down to personal preference i.e. auto completion for convenience
> versus a final "manual sign off" of the parent task. The advantage of
> the latter is that sometimes completion of the parent task might
> require additional subtasks which have been unforeseen or due to
> changed circumstances and this is an opportunity to review. Perhaps
> this preference could be a program option.

> > I am trying out the RC and I like the idea of the little progress bar
> > in the outline view.  Now I have two questions regarding its use:
>
> > - Can I make it visible in the To-Do-View?
> > - What is it based on?  I do not seem to be able to get to 100%
> > completion.  Let's say I add four (4) tasks under a parent (folder)
> > project.  If I tick off one after the other, I would expect the
> > progress bar to indicate that I am making progress in increments of
> > 1/4 until I reach 100% completion with ticking off the fourth and last
> > task.  But this is not so.  There always seems to be one last step
> > missing, so in this case the progress bar seems to indicate progress
> > by 1/5 although there are only four (4) tasks assigned to this project
> > (folder).  This strikes me as wrong.  Am I missing something?
